About the Role
We’re seeking a highly organized, analytical, and collaborative Accountant to join our team. This individual will play a critical role in managing day-to-day financial operations, supporting growth, and ensuring compliance with internal controls and regulatory standards. This is a unique opportunity to work at the intersection of finance and fashion, contribute to high-impact projects, and help scale a dynamic, multi-revenue stream business.
Responsibilities
Prepare and manage monthly invoicing across retainers, partnerships, special projects, and events
Maintain the general ledger and lead month-end close activities
Create, manage, and track annual budgets and financial forecasts
Deliver monthly reports including P&L, Balance Sheet, Statement of Cash Flows, and Aging Reports
Analyze budget variances and provide summary feedback to leadership
Compliance & Controls
Ensure accurate and consistent application of US GAAP standards
Implement and manage financial controls in line with internal policies and external regulations
Partner with CPA for tax planning, filings, and financial audits
Ensure timely and accurate tax, payroll, and compliance reporting
Cash Flow & Treasury
Monitor daily cash flow and maintain adequate liquidity to meet operational needs
Prepare cash flow and financial activity reports for senior leadership
Team & Operations
Expenses, AP/AR, payroll, tax, treasury, and audit
Support onboarding and other basic HR accounting functions
Review and manage insurance policies and requirements
Liaise across departments to ensure clear financial communication and understanding
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field
CPA certification (required)
4+ years of accounting or bookkeeping experience, ideally in a fast-paced, creative, or agency environment
Experience managing multiple revenue streams and complex client billing models
Strong command of accounting systems (e.g., QuickBooks) and Excel/Google Sheets
Familiarity with payroll platforms such as Paychex or ADP is a plus
Excellent communication skills and a proactive, problem-solving attitude
Ability to work independently and collaborate across teams
